Sni proxy list

Sni proxy list. Dec 19, 2019 · Since SNI or even http_host header ( HTTP ) would match the url filter, the site is really not the real site but the traffic would be accepted and passed by the NGFW. e. We can see the request details with -v option. Some media players don't support SNI and thus won't work with Dockerflix. 5 and the ngx_stream_map module added in 1. 5 (debian) and try to setup what is mentioned here: "how-to-set-ssl-verify-client-for-specific-domain-name" my haproxy is located behind a firewall and requests are NATed i’d like to have some users that are not in the networks_allowed list, to present a certificate. You can use our API URL to get the proxy list on all systems. This free proxy list provides free socks4, socks5 and HTTP . You need a full-blown proxy if you want to check DNS and matching AltName or CN in a certificate. In the case of curl, the SNI depends on the URL so I add “Host header” option. If you want to get SNI and bump, then peek at step #1 and bump at the next step (i. SNI Proxy for HTTPS Pass-through. The server can only work on the same computer you use for internet surfing, occupying 53, 443, 3080 port for handling dns exchanges, SNI proxying and serving web configuration UI. You can create a crt-list file, for example crt-list. Since you enabled mutual TLS between the sidecar proxies and the egress gateway, you can monitor the service identity of the applications that access external services, and enforce policies based on the identities of the traffic source. As a result, the server can display several certificates on the same port and IP address. Now, there are many proxies available to proxy layer-4 based on the TLS SNI extension, including Nginx. The main reason is to allow other users to connect with your Sandstorm instance in the standard HTTPS port (443) and keep using that port also for any other web apps. A website owner can require SNI support, either by allowing their host to do this for them, or by directly consolidating multiple hostnames onto a smaller number of IP addresses. SNI Proxy to SOCKS/HTTP Proxy Topics. Apr 3, 2023 · Setting Up an SNI Proxy Using Vultr ¶ In this tutorial, we will go over the steps to set up an SNI proxy using Vultr as a service provider. Jul 23, 2023 · I use curl command on Windows WSL to change the FQDN between TLS SNI and HTTP host header. com , where A1 - A. Additionally, web traffic is evolving: with HTTP/2, multiple hostnames can be multiplexed in a single TCP stream preventing SNI Proxy from routing it correctly based on hostname, and HTTP/3 (QUIC) uses UDP transport. OCSP settings must go into a crt-list file. 10:443 mode tcp tcp-request inspect-delay 5s tcp-request content accept if { req_ssl_hello_type 1 } acl application_1 req_ssl_sni -i application1. 🧷 自用的一个功能很简单的 SNIProxy 顺便分享出来给有同样需求的人,用得上的话可以点个⭐支持下~. com, B. 2. It achieves this by first using SNI to direct proxy or Kubernetes traffic, then uses ALPN to be able to know which service to route to. Proxy Server List - this page provides and maintains the largest and the most up-to-date list of working proxy servers that are available for public use. ONE/EN/ Free proxy list: Proxy list by country: Anonymous free proxy: HTTPS/SSL proxy: SOCKS proxy list: Feb 22, 2015 · I am having problems connecting via SNI Proxy server using Python, the following code snippet shows the connection and executing the script results in different connection errors (handshake, wrong version) depending upon which version of ssl is used: Monitor the SNI and the source identity, and enforce access policies based on them. SNIProxy 是一个根据传入域名(SNI)来自动端口转发至该域名源服务器的工具,常用于网站多服务器负载均衡,而且因为是通过明文的 SNI 来获取目标域名,因此不需要 SSL 解密再加密,转发速度和效率 Custom Domain Handling: Matches DNS queries to a list of specified domains and returns corresponding IP addresses. 11. Back in 2013 the answer to this question pointed out Squid's incapability of SNI. Iranian Proxy List - Proxies from Iran. txt) or can be directly accessed via our proxy API. Would disabling HTTPs Inspection or adding the domain in question to Selective Decryption List help? Answer: No, this would not help. With HAProxy we have 2 options to load balance based on the server name indicator (SNI): · SSL session termination at the load balancer (Mode HTTP) Oct 24, 2016 · An SNI proxy receives connections on port 443, peeks at the SNI, then forwards the connection to the host given in the SNI. txt, that has one line for each of the certificates you want to bind to. SNI, or Server Name Indication, is an addition to the TLS encryption protocol that enables a client device to specify the domain name it is trying to reach in the first step of the TLS handshake, preventing common name mismatch errors. com need to be forwarded to Apr 8, 2017 · I have this NGINX configuration as follows: # jelastic is a wildcard certificate for *. It's not a MITM; the proxy forwards the client's ClientHello and all other traffic unmodified, and the client has a true end-to-end TLS connection to the server, through the SNI proxy. 1 day ago · Open Proxy List is your one-stop destination for accessing a wide variety of free proxy and VPN servers from around the world. The HTTPS request will fail if a basic TLS handshake is not carried out (for example if the Client / Server Hello exchange is missing). (default: 0. I am trying to access my domains from multiple modern browsers guaranteed to have SNI support (firefoxes, chromes, opera and more). I want to use TLS passthrough on Kubernetes route. I would not like to install additional software like HAProxy or sniproxy. This list can be found in their respective documentation on Kong Hub. a TLS connection needs to be. net — Unlimited traffic Have a free proxy list Up to 700 Mbps speed Price from $0. 1n 15 Mar 2022 TLS SNI support enabled However I suspect that SNI is not in effect. This project implements a transparent proxy that accepts TLS connection, parses the initial client greeting and proxies the complete SSL session to the backend corresponding to the server's name (or default backend if no SNI specified). - liulilittle/sniproxy 🧷 自用的一个功能很简单的 SNIProxy 顺便分享出来给有同样需求的人,用得上的话可以点个⭐支持下~. Stars. Traffic going to that hostname on port 80 (http) will hit the cache container and be cached, whilst traffic on port 443 (https) is passed straight through to the internet by the SNI Proxy container. This allows Nginx to read the TLS Client Hello and decide based on the SNI extension which backend to use. Jun 27, 2016 · All HTTP(S) requests shall go through a caching proxy server for speed and sharing the server IP. Oct 4, 2017 · Hi, i am on haproxy 1. 0. I have no more ideas, what to try. If you don't have one, you can sign up for free using my Vultr referal link Nginx was compiled with SNI support enabled: > nginx -VC nginx version: nginx/1. As requested I am adding the other virtualhosts here. 🔥 Proxy is a high performance HTTP(S) proxies, SOCKS5 proxies,WEBSOCKET, TCP, UDP proxy server implemented by golang. 0 and later. An SNI proxy is like an open proxy Dec 21, 2021 · Using SNI & ALPN to reduce Teleport proxy port requirements. SNIProxy does not need the TLS encryption keys and cannot decrypt the TLS traffic that goes through. SNI¶. What browsers support SNI? Here is a quick list of the supported browsers: Mozilla Firefox version 2. Now, it supports chain-style proxies,nat forwarding in different lan,TCP/UDP port forwarding, SSH forwarding. 0 license Activity. proxies and can be downloaded in a text file format (. domain. Is SWG Proxy able to process non-standard HTTPS web requests? Answer: No. SNI Proxy: Proxies non-matching domains to their respective addresses. We provide a comprehensive list of OpenVPN, HTTP, SOCKS, and V2Ray servers, all designed to help you browse the internet safely, privately, and without restrictions. but on loading the page, firefox complains about SSL 6 hours ago · Open Proxy List is your one-stop destination for accessing a wide variety of free proxy and VPN servers from around the world. Dec 13, 2019 · I want to use Apache HTTP server as a Reverse Proxy for a set of microservices hosted in OpenShift or Kubernetes. /SNI-Proxy -list domains -PIP < YOUR SERVER IP > You can create service for the binary: [Unit] Description =SNI Proxy [Service] Jan 21, 2023 · HAproxy manages all certs (auto updates as well as new and with A+ ssl ratings if possible) To accomplish this, I would switch almost all of your configs to mode http instead of tcp so that HAProxy can do all the TLS negotiation. Contribute to lancachenet/sniproxy development by creating an account on GitHub. com, C. here is a recap of my need : I have 1 single public IP address, I need the following at the same time : I have a domain , smalldragoon. others should be routed without certificate. SNI(Server Name Indication)是TLS协议的扩展,包含在TLS握手的流程中(Client Hello),用来标识所访问目标主机名。SNI代理通过解析TLS握手信息中的SNI部分,从而获取目标访问地址。 SNI代理同时也接受HTTP请求,使用HTTP的Host头作为目标访问地址。 标准SNI代理¶ Jan 10, 2018 · I also tried to setup an ordinary second HTTPS site (without reverse proxy) and the result was the same. An example given illustrates a constructed URL targeting a specific word, database, and entry number, as well as an instance of a PHP script being potentially misused to connect to a DICT server using attacker-provided credentials: dict://<generic_user>;<auth>@<generic_host>:<port 1 day ago · Open Proxy List is your one-stop destination for accessing a wide variety of free proxy and VPN servers from around the world. You can custom the output format of the proxy list using our API. Chromecast) ignore your DNS settings and Buy SNI Proxy at PAPAproxy. For the proxy server there's not much special about tracking each of the flows - that's what proxy servers do. For example, if you Enhanced sni-proxy supports "HTTP, HTTP-SSL" and reverse proxy, and can be used to unlock streaming media resources of "Netflix, Disney+, TVB and TikTok". At the beginning of the TLS handshake, it enables a client or browser to specify the hostname it is attempting to connect to. (default: 80) --tls-address= IP address the SNI proxy server will be listening for TLS connections. Proxy Providers Proxy Providers give users the power to load proxy server lists dynamically, instead of hardcoding them in the configuration file. The proxy has a list of hostname and their corresponding backend servers. Windows users can use our free App to get and test the HTTP proxy lists. Back to top. (default: 443) --bandwidth-rate= Bytes per The purpose of this tutorial is to set up SNI Proxy so it’s possible to use Sandstorm verified SSL encryption while coexisting with another web server that also uses SSL. Our proxy lists are updated every 30 minutes. The SNI is contained in TLS handshakes and SNIProxy uses it to route connections to backends. Proxy TLS passthrough traffic. As a result of the CONNECT request a tunnel between client and the requested final server is established. Apr 13, 2012 · # Adjust the timeout to your needs defaults timeout client 30s timeout server 30s timeout connect 5s # Single VIP with sni content switching frontend ft_ssl_vip bind 10. First server: TLS server name extension has been defined since TLS 1. shared-hosting. https http-proxy sniproxy socks5-proxy Resources. Nov 3, 2023 · While transmitting its data in plain text during the TLS handshake, SNI may expose sensitive information to hackers and malicious actors. The DICT URL scheme is described as being utilized for accessing definitions or word lists via the DICT protocol. 2. A crt-list file enumerates the certificates bound to a listener and describes metadata about each certificate, such as ALPN, minimum TLS version, and OCSP. curl -v https://<FQDN [SNI]> -H 'Host: <FQDN [Host header]>' Below are the logs of the request. . Jun 25, 2020 · You can leverage this to make many different physical servers accessible from the Internet even if you have only one public IPv4 address: the proxy listens on your public IP address and forwards connections to the appropriate private IP address based on the SNI. Server Name Indication (SNI) is an extension to the Transport Layer Security (TLS) computer networking protocol by which a client indicates which hostname it is attempting to connect to at the start of the handshaking process. This is usually caused by the site being behind cloudflare or a similar multi-tenant reverse proxy. SNIProxy is a TLS proxy, based on the TLS Server Name Indication (SNI). Our powerful software checks over a million proxy servers daily, with most proxies tested at least once every 15 minutes, thus creating one of the most Apr 22, 2024 · Server name identification (SNI) describes when a client chooses a domain name (hosted on a shared IP address) it's trying to reach, initiates the SSL/TLS handshake, and then identifies the correct SSL/TLS certificate while accessing that resource. The site you're visiting terminated the TLS handshake because it cares about the SNI field. SNIProxy 是一个根据传入域名(SNI)来自动端口转发至该域名源服务器的工具,常用于网站多服务器负载均衡,而且因为是通过明文的 SNI 来获取目标域名,因此不需要 SSL 解密再加密,转发速度和效率 Apr 28, 2022 · Hi, I’m using haproxy through PfSense and as I’m not able to have my conf working, I was wondering if what I need is possible or not, hence my question here. Parsing TLS Client Hello does not preclude future bumping. 7. However, since Squid 3. This will allow you to serve multiple SSL-enabled websites from a single IP address. Our proxy list service supports all systems, including Windows, Mac, Linux, Android, and iOS. Configurable: Uses a config. 0) --tls-port= Port the SNI proxy server will be listening for TLS connections. Apache-2. The final server will only see anything from this tunnel. sudo . Jan 18, 2019 · bypass-GFW-SNI-proxy. 6 hours ago · Open Proxy List is your one-stop destination for accessing a wide variety of free proxy and VPN servers from around the world. , step #2): 1 day ago · Open Proxy List is your one-stop destination for accessing a wide variety of free proxy and VPN servers from around the world. It reads the hostname from the SNI information and then forwards everything on to the appropriate server. SPYS. xyz server { listen 443; server_name _; ssl on; ssl_certificate 代理方式请参考 bypass-GFW-SNI/proxy。 此“半” POC 程序可以在不自行架设境外服务器的情况下,直接访问符合特定条件的被中国防火长城(“GFW”)屏蔽的站点。TL;DR,是通过类似域前置的方式突破了 GFW 的 SNI 封锁。 Free open proxy servers list - country: TZ - Tanzania. Our proxy backend with over nine proxy checkers and three proxy scrapes updates the proxies every second to make sure you get the best free proxy list. 18. Although there is an encrypted version of SNI, it doesn’t offer a guarantee of security. There are currently two sources for a proxy provider to load server list from: http: Clash loads the server list from a specified URL on This is a local DNS and HTTPS server, using man-in-the-middle approach to bypass SNI based filtering. json file to define behavior for specified domains. I believe Apache should be able to handle it. example # domain name port: 443 # gateway's service port, 0 means any port connect: # the address that the agent will connect to publish the service host: 127. A few media players (i. Kong Gateway supports proxying a TLS request without terminating or known as SNI proxy. 5 it supports SNI with peek-and-splice. 5 stars Watchers. Prerequisites ¶ - A Vultr account. This extension allows to specify the exact server name to connect. Proxy是golang实现的高性能http,https,websocket,tcp,socks5 Custom Domain Handling: Matches DNS queries to a list of specified domains and returns corresponding IP addresses. com acl application Jan 12, 2016 · This is now possible with the addition of the ngx_stream_ssl_preread module added in Nginx 1. Putting it all together, Teleport has made use of the properties of SNI & ALPN extensions to reduce proxy port requirements down to one port. 1. Thus, the solution should offer SSL termination and SNI. 1 # ip address or domain name port: 443 # port protocol: TCP # protocol, TCP means it acts as a SNI (default: 0. Feb 23, 2024 · Which protocols support SNI? Server Name Indication (SNI) is a TLS protocol addon. Since SNI is needed by the server to select the certificate it is also needed when HTTPS is send over a proxy - otherwise the server would not know which certificate to select. 07 for IP/month — 100k+ IPv4 proxies publish_hosts: # list of the services that this agent will publish-host: tls. Server Name Indication, often abbreviated SNI, is an extension to TLS that allows multiple hostnames to be served over HTTPS from the same IP address. If you need to proxy plain old SSLv1/v2 for a device, have a look at the non-SNI approach in tunlr-style-dns-unblocking. Readme License. i. Feb 16, 2024 · 🔗 Peek at SNI and Bump SNI is obtained by parsing TLS Client Hello during step #2 (which is instructed by ssl_bump peek step1). DNS 方式请参考 bypass-GFW-SNI/main。 此“半” POC 程序可以在不自行架设境外服务器的情况下,直接访问符合特定条件的被中国防火长城(“GFW”)屏蔽的站点。TL;DR,是通过类似域前置的方式突破了 GFW 的 SNI 封锁。 特定条件 Dockerflix only handles requests using plain HTTP or TLS using the SNI extension. [1] Aug 8, 2023 · Are you curious to read about and find the Server Name Indication (SNI) supporting details for your web hosting solution? SNI allows multiple websites to share the same IP address. The latest developments in protecting privacy on the internet include encrypted TLS server name indication (ESNI) and encrypted DNS in the form of DNS over HTTPS (DoH), both of which are considered highly controversial by data collectors. Note: In L4 proxy mode, only plugins that has tcp or tls in the supported protocol list are supported. 0) --http-port= Port the SNI proxy server will be listening for plain HTTP connections. 0 built with OpenSSL 1. smalldragoon. Do all web servers and browsers support SNI? May 24, 2018 · HAProxy modes: TCP vs HTTP. SNI Proxy allows hostnames that serve BOTH http and https content to be overridden and pointed to your cache server. 1. uydppp tjjx kejdoe byvj rsnbpt oeq iuwzc ypap sciun unwiw